Submission on the proposed Care and Support Sector Code of Conduct - November 2021

This submission responds to the Department of Health’s proposed Code of Conduct for the Care and Support Sector.  PCA supports the introduction of a code of conduct for aged care,  which will help ensure that aged care recipients are protected from exploitation, abuse and inappropriate and/or unprofessional conduct.  However, PCA does have some concerns about the proposed code including addressing learnings from the current NDIS code of conduct, duplication of professional standards and practices, implications for personal care workers and addressing diverse needs in the code.  In this submission PCA continues to call for measures that support the professionalisation of the personal care workforce and believes this is the best way to ensure that staff are trained and prepared to deliver palliative care.  The code should also be supported by appropriate guidance training which interacts with other aged care provider and worker requirements.
